Change Control & Quality Specialist

Location: Folkestone Job Type: Full-Time Temporary

Are you an experienced Quality professional with a passion for driving change, maintaining compliance, and improving quality systems? We're recruiting on behalf of a leading international manufacturer for a Change Control & Quality Specialist to join their European Quality team on a 6 month Temporary basis.

This is an exciting opportunity to play a key role in managing change control activities across Europe while supporting continuous improvement initiatives within a highly regulated environment.

The Role

Reporting to the European Head of Quality, you will be responsible for overseeing the European Change Control programme, ensuring quality processes remain compliant with GMP and regulatory requirements. You'll work collaboratively with teams across Europe and globally to deliver successful change initiatives and maintain an audit-ready quality management system.

Key Responsibilities

* Lead and manage the European Change Control programme for temporary and permanent changes. * Review change requests, assess business impact, and ensure compliance with GMP and applicable regulations. * Coordinate stakeholders throughout the change control process. * Monitor progress of change actions and ensure completion within agreed deadlines. * Produce KPI reports and analyse change control performance. * Identify opportunities to improve quality systems and change management processes. * Deliver training, coaching and guidance on Change Control procedures. * Maintain audit readiness and support internal and external audits. * Support quality investigations, CAPA activities and continuous improvement initiatives. * Assist in the development and maintenance of the Quality Management System (QMS). * Ensure documentation, records and quality files are accurately maintained.

About You

We're looking for someone who has:

* A degree in Science, Engineering or a related discipline. * At least three years' experience within a Quality or Technical function. * Experience working within a regulated industry such as Pharmaceuticals, Medical Devices or FMCG. * Strong knowledge of GMP and Quality Management Systems. * Experience managing change control processes and implementing quality improvements. * Knowledge of ISO 13485, ISO 22716, MDD and MDR. * Experience supporting audits and regulatory inspections. *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ills. * Strong analytical skills with experience producing KPIs and trend analysis. * A proactive approach with excellent attention to detail and a continuous improvement mindset.

You will be working 37 hours week Monday to Friday based between 2 sites and there may be the opportunity to work 1 day at home once full training is complete
